Re: [asterisk-dev] Deadlock in pthread_exit due to lazy binding with libgcc

2015-07-19 Thread Yousf Ateya
Here is the difference in loading time (on Intel i5 machine):

The default (with lazy linking): 1.422 seconds
With non-lazy linking: 1.852 seconds

[asterisk-dev] Deadlock in pthread_exit due to lazy binding with libgcc

2015-07-15 Thread Yousf Ateya
Dear,

I started to see a  strange deadlock in some asterisk nodes. For every
call, when calling pthread_exit from pbx_thread, the caller thread is stuck
inside pthread_exit.

After a while, there will be tens-of-thousands of threads having the same
backtrace. After some googling, I found this happens because of the default
lazy linking of gcc linker.

Related issue of stackoverflow:
http://stackoverflow.com/questions/11954527/dlopen-malloc-deadlock

Tried to recompile asterisk using:
export LDFLAGS=-Wl,-z,now
./configure  make  make install

and this deadlock problem didn't happen again; the problem cause is lazy
binding with libgcc.

Shall we add this option by default or add it in menuselect?

I am using Asterisk 13.4 compiled on Ubuntu 14.04 64 bit with gcc 4.8.2,
but probably this applies to other OSs/compilers.



Deadlock backtrace


Thread 6138 (Thread 0x2acfc684b700 (LWP 12259)):
#0  __lll_lock_wait () at
../nptl/sysdeps/unix/sysv/linux/x86_64/lowlevellock.S:135
#1  0x2ace66628672 in _L_lock_953 () from
/lib/x86_64-linux-gnu/libpthread.so.0
#2  0x2ace666284da in __GI___pthread_mutex_lock (mutex=0x2ace64b1b968
_rtld_global+2312) at ../nptl/pthread_mutex_lock.c:114
#3  0x2ace6490c34e in _dl_open (file=0x2ace66630ccf libgcc_s.so.1,
mode=-2147483647, caller_dlopen=0x2ace6662ea43 pthread_cancel_init+35,
nsid=-2, argc=1, argv=0x7fff1f751498, env=0x1907320)
at dl-open.c:613
#4  0x2ace670c30f2 in do_dlopen (ptr=ptr@entry=0x2acfc684ad80) at
dl-libc.c:87
#5  0x2ace64907ff4 in _dl_catch_error (objname=0x2acfc684ad60,
errstring=0x2acfc684ad70, mallocedp=0x2acfc684ad50, operate=0x2ace670c30b0
do_dlopen, args=0x2acfc684ad80) at dl-error.c:187
#6  0x2ace670c31b2 in dlerror_run (args=0x2acfc684ad80,
operate=0x2ace670c30b0 do_dlopen) at dl-libc.c:46
#7  __GI___libc_dlopen_mode (name=optimized out, mode=optimized out) at
dl-libc.c:163
#8  0x2ace6662ea43 in pthread_cancel_init () at
../nptl/sysdeps/pthread/unwind-forcedunwind.c:52
#9  0x2ace6662ec0c in _Unwind_ForcedUnwind (exc=0x2acfc684bd70,
stop=stop@entry=0x2ace6662cbc0 unwind_stop, stop_argument=0x2acfc684ae60)
at ../nptl/sysdeps/pthread/unwind-forcedunwind.c:129
#10 0x2ace6662cd40 in __GI___pthread_unwind (buf=optimized out) at
unwind.c:129
#11 0x2ace66627535 in __do_cancel () at pthreadP.h:280
#12 __pthread_exit (value=value@entry=0x0) at pthread_exit.c:29
#13 0x0057a523 in pbx_thread (data=data@entry=0x2acf0c171588) at
pbx.c:6773
#14 0x005d734a in dummy_start (data=optimized out) at utils.c:1237
#15 0x2ace66626182 in start_thread (arg=0x2acfc684b700) at
pthread_create.c:312
#16 0x2ace6708747d in clone () at
../sysdeps/unix/sysv/linux/x86_64/clone.S:111
